Types of Braces We Offer

Traditional Metal Braces

  • Most effective for severe misalignment
  • Uses high-quality stainless steel brackets & wires
  • Suitable for children, teens, and adults

Clear (Ceramic) Braces

  • Less visible than metal braces
  • Provides the same effectiveness with a more aesthetic look
  • A great option for adults & teens

Invisalign® – Clear Aligners

  • Nearly invisible, removable, and comfortable
  • Customized aligners for gradual teeth alignment
  • Ideal for adults and teens wanting a discreet orthodontic treatment

Frequently Asked Questions About Braces

How long does orthodontic treatment take?

Treatment time varies depending on the severity of the case but typically ranges between 12 to 24 months.

Do braces hurt?

You may feel mild discomfort for the first few days after getting braces or after adjustments, but this is temporary and manageable.

What foods should I avoid with braces?

Avoid sticky, hard, and chewy foods like gum, popcorn, and hard candies to prevent damage to your brackets and wires.

How often should I visit the orthodontist during treatment?

You’ll typically visit every 4 to 6 weeks for adjustments and progress checks.
